Recently I bought a "ConnectPort X5" satellite system from Ax-Man Surplus, and wanted to see what it does. In this video we're opening it up, poking around at all the parts inside, and then messing with the on-board computer and communications systems to see what it does.

This is the type of rooftop dome you'd see on a semi truck or other vehicle, allowing fleet owners to track and monitor their trucks and cargo. It has an Orbcomm satellite modem, GPS, Wifi, Xbee, Cellular modem, Ethernet, Serial port, and some other sensors and interfaces.

The hardest part was finding the power inputs for the weird interface block. This didn't come with any hardware documentation, although the software documentation on the web panel is very extensive.
